  2. History of SEARCH Understanding Change program planning 1. Started with Arctic Oscillation Hypothesis AO shifted, and the Arctic didn’t. 2. “Is Arctic moving to a new state” hypothesis? Answering whether Arctic has moved to a new state no longer urgent before science program really started. • Arctic environment is changing faster than science can mobilize to understand and predict it, much less plan for the consequences. • Policy environment shifting – from “is it happening?” to “what to do about it?”

  3. Need for Understanding Activities • On a national and global scale: need science to support well-informed mitigation policy, i.e., • How soon will ____ happen? • Can we afford to wait 20 years to begin deep cuts in greenhouse gas emissions? • On a local and regional scale: need science to support well-informed adaptation policy, i.e., • Arctic marine and terrestrial ecosystem management • Arctic infrastructure and settlement policy

Regime shifts in climate and the environment, unprecedented in the historical and recent geological record Sweeping impacts of change on Northern populations and cultures Increasing interdependence between the Arctic region and global processes Expansion of global geopolitical and economic interests into the North Human and Natural Systems Linked Across Local and Global Scales Hajo Eicken SEARCH SSC meeting, 11/30/05

  6. What are some of the high-priority needs for increased understanding Based on: • Urgency of need for increased understanding? • Readiness for progress by coordination of ongoing activities? • Fit to SEARCH program objectives and observations?
